If you are really interested in learning to play guitar, then you need to be committed to practicing most daily. Part of learning to play well is memorizing chords and scales, having the ability to move from one to the other without thinking. This ability could only come by a lot of practice. Aim to get at least a half-hour daily, as you progress, moving up to an hour. Just like the majority of worthy jobs, learning to play the guitar is likely not going to be something accomplished overnight. Therefore, it is important that you keep your eye on the broader goal of becoming a skilled musician and stop yourself from getting impatient because you haven't yet mastered your favorite songs. Stay focused, and you will get where you want to go in time. It bears repeating that practice is the most important thing you can do when learning how to play guitar. Don't plan on practicing long session every week, for a single. Practicing consistently daily, even for brief amounts of time, is equally significant and the best way to develop the finger memory you'll need for guitar. Educate the muscles on your fingers. Many novice guitarists become discouraged by the pain, and muscle cramping that often accompanies the first couple weeks of studying. Pay attention to the internet, or get a good guitar exercise book, and use your first few minutes of practice each day concentrating on finger exercises. This will help you to build up callouses on your fingers, and strength in your finger muscles to keep them from cramping. Practice playing daily. Try and exercise your guitar playing with around one hour every day, if you can. When you practice, you will get used to different finger positions, and you're going to have the ability to consider the chords much more easily. By giving yourself a opportunity to play each day, you will be made a better guitar player. Try and aim to learn one easy song each week. Practicing your scales can get old. To keep yourself from becoming frustrated the first couple of times you play the guitar, prepare yourself for sore fingers. The strings are made from steel, and palms without calluses experience irritation if they strum steel and over again. Fight the pain before your fingers develop calluses and the pain ceases. Don't forget to stretch. Playing with guitar can be hazardous to your health if you are not taking the appropriate precautions. Learn stretching exercises for your hands. Keep them elastic and work the muscles inside them when you aren't practicing the guitar. Not extending frequently can lead to injury.
